The 2021 AIG Women's British Open field is set with the passing of the typical Friday entry deadline. The field is set for this event, played at Carnoustie Golf Links in Scotland.

The AIG Women's British Open field is headlined by the likes of Inbee Park, Lydia Ko, Lexi Thompson and more.

This is set to be a 125-player field is played out over four days, with this event marking the final major of five on the LPGA calendar.

The tournament is being played in its originally intended slot.

We do not have Monday qualifiers for this event.

The week-of alternate list is based on the LPGA Tour's eligibility criteria.

The field will be playing for a $4.5 million purse, with 39 of the top 50 in the Rolex Women's World Golf Ranking among the top contenders.
